Career path
Career Roles in Satellite Imagery for Irrigation Management
- Data Analyst - Utilize satellite imagery to analyze irrigation data and improve crop management practices.
- Remote Sensing Specialist - Apply remote sensing techniques to monitor water usage and optimize irrigation systems.
- GIS Technician - Manage geographical information systems to visualize and analyze irrigation patterns.
- Agricultural Engineer - Design irrigation systems that integrate satellite data for enhanced agricultural productivity.
- Research Scientist - Conduct research on the impact of satellite imagery on irrigation efficiency and sustainable agriculture.
